Indeterminate growth in plants refers to the continuous or unlimited growth throughout their life cycle. This means that they can keep growing in size and producing new structures such as branches, leaves, and flowers as long as they are alive. This type of growth is common in perennial plants and is regulated by environmental conditions, genetics, and biotic factors.

Tomato plants are classified as determinate or indeterminate. Determinate plants will bear their fruit once at relatively the same time. Indeterminate will grow fruits throughout the growing season.
